Understanding Investment Returns in the Indian Market

Investing in the Indian market, whether through the National Stock Exchange (NSE), the Bombay Stock Exchange (BSE), mutual funds, or other avenues, is a journey towards financial growth. But understanding the actual performance of your investments can be tricky. Many investors simply look at the overall gain or loss, but that doesn’t paint the full picture, especially when considering investments held over multiple years or those with irregular contributions.

That’s where understanding average annual returns becomes crucial. It provides a standardized way to compare the performance of different investments, regardless of their holding periods or the pattern of your contributions.

Why Average Annual Returns Matter to Indian Investors

For Indian investors, particularly those navigating the complexities of SIPs (Systematic Investment Plans), ELSS (Equity Linked Savings Schemes), PPF (Public Provident Fund), NPS (National Pension System), and other investment vehicles, understanding average annual returns is essential for:

  • Performance Comparison: Allows you to compare the performance of different mutual funds, stocks, or investment strategies on a level playing field. For example, you can easily compare the returns of two ELSS funds to see which one has performed better.
  • Goal Setting: Helps you estimate how long it will take to achieve your financial goals, such as retirement planning or saving for a down payment on a house.
  • Risk Assessment: Provides insights into the volatility of your investments. Higher average annual returns may come with higher risks, which you need to be aware of.
  • Portfolio Optimization: Enables you to identify underperforming assets in your portfolio and make informed decisions about rebalancing.
  • Understanding the Impact of Compounding: Showcases the power of compounding over time, particularly important for long-term investments like PPF and NPS.

What is Average Annual Return?

Average annual return represents the percentage of profit or loss an investment generates annually over a specific period. It smooths out fluctuations in returns, providing a more consistent view of performance. It is calculated by assuming the investment grows at a constant rate each year to reach its final value.

It’s important to differentiate between simple average return and annualized average return. Simple average return just adds up all the yearly returns and divides by the number of years. This method is suitable for short time horizons, but it doesn’t accurately reflect the impact of compounding on your returns over longer periods.

Annualized average return, on the other hand, considers the compounding effect, providing a more accurate representation of your investment’s growth over time. This is the type of return we are discussing in this article, and what investment professionals typically use.

Different Methods for Calculating Average Annual Return

There are several methods to calculate the average annual return, each with its own advantages and disadvantages:

1. Arithmetic Mean Return

This is the simplest method, where you add up all the periodic returns and divide by the number of periods. However, it doesn’t account for compounding, and it can be misleading for investments with volatile returns.

Formula: (Sum of all returns) / (Number of years)

Example: If an investment returned 10%, 5%, and 15% over three years, the arithmetic mean return would be (10 + 5 + 15) / 3 = 10%.

2. Geometric Mean Return

The geometric mean is a more accurate measure of average annual return because it considers the compounding effect. It’s calculated by multiplying all the periodic returns, adding 1 to each, taking the nth root (where n is the number of periods), and then subtracting 1.

Formula: [(1 + Return 1) (1 + Return 2) … (1 + Return n)]^(1/n) – 1

Example: Using the same returns as above (10%, 5%, and 15%), the geometric mean return would be [(1 + 0.10) (1 + 0.05) (1 + 0.15)]^(1/3) – 1 = 0.0982 or 9.82%.

Why is this more accurate? Because it reflects that a loss in one year requires a larger percentage gain in the following year to recover fully.

3. XIRR (Extended Internal Rate of Return)

XIRR is particularly useful for investments with irregular cash flows, such as SIPs or real estate. It calculates the discount rate at which the net present value of all cash flows equals zero. It’s commonly used by mutual fund companies to report the returns of their schemes.

XIRR calculation requires a dedicated function in spreadsheet software like Microsoft Excel or Google Sheets. You need to input the dates and amounts of all cash flows (both investments and withdrawals), and the software will calculate the XIRR.

Important Note: While XIRR is accurate for calculating returns on irregular cash flows, it can be sensitive to the timing and magnitude of those cash flows. Small changes in the cash flows can sometimes lead to significant changes in the calculated XIRR.

How to Calculate Average Annual Return: A Practical Guide

Let’s walk through a practical example of calculating the average annual return for a mutual fund investment:

Scenario: You invested ₹10,000 in a mutual fund three years ago. The current value of your investment is ₹13,310.

Using the Geometric Mean Method:

  1. Calculate the Total Return: (₹13,310 – ₹10,000) / ₹10,000 = 0.331 or 33.1%
  2. Annualize the Return: (1 + 0.331)^(1/3) – 1 = 0.10 or 10%

Therefore, the average annual return of your mutual fund investment is 10%.

Using an Average Annual Rate of Return Calculator

Manually calculating average annual returns can be time-consuming and prone to errors, especially for complex investments with multiple cash flows. Thankfully, various financial websites and apps offer tools to simplify this process.

An average annual rate of return calculator can save you significant time and effort. These calculators typically require you to input the initial investment amount, the final investment value, and the number of years the investment was held. Some calculators also allow you to input irregular cash flows for a more accurate calculation using the XIRR method.

Where to Find Calculators:

  • Financial Websites: Websites like Value Research, ET Money, and Groww offer free online calculators for calculating investment returns.
  • Mutual Fund Company Websites: Many mutual fund companies have calculators on their websites that are specific to their schemes.
  • Financial Planning Apps: Numerous apps are available on both Android and iOS that provide portfolio tracking and return calculation features.
  • Spreadsheet Software: As mentioned earlier, spreadsheet programs like Microsoft Excel and Google Sheets have built-in functions like XIRR for calculating returns on investments with irregular cash flows.

Limitations of Average Annual Return

While average annual return is a useful metric, it’s important to be aware of its limitations:

  • Doesn’t Guarantee Future Performance: Past performance is not necessarily indicative of future results. Market conditions can change, and an investment that has performed well in the past may not continue to do so in the future.
  • Doesn’t Reflect Volatility: Average annual return doesn’t tell you anything about the volatility of an investment. Two investments may have the same average annual return, but one may have experienced much larger fluctuations in value than the other.
  • Susceptible to Manipulation: Average annual returns can be manipulated by changing the starting and ending dates of the calculation. A fund manager might choose a period where the fund performed exceptionally well to showcase a higher average annual return.
  • Doesn’t Account for Taxes and Fees: The calculated return doesn’t consider the impact of taxes or investment management fees, which can significantly reduce your actual returns.

Beyond Average Annual Return: A Holistic View of Investment Performance

While calculating average annual returns is a useful tool, remember to consider other factors when evaluating investment performance:

  • Risk-Adjusted Return: Measures the return earned for each unit of risk taken. Common metrics include Sharpe Ratio and Sortino Ratio.
  • Volatility (Standard Deviation): Measures the degree to which an investment’s returns fluctuate over time.
  • Expense Ratio: The annual fee charged by a mutual fund or ETF, expressed as a percentage of assets under management.
  • Investment Goals and Time Horizon: Your investment choices should align with your financial goals and the time horizon you have to achieve them.
  • Qualitative Factors: Consider factors such as the fund manager’s experience, the investment strategy, and the fund’s asset allocation.
